I have a stateless session with a large number of rules most of which set
values used elsewhere in the application so looping is a big issue.  The
rules have been organized into a ruleflows in order to foster orchestration. 
As a very clean approach to avoid looping (i.e., avoiding adding control to
rules) I added an AgendaFilter that tracks the rules that have been fired.  

Several previous posts discuss that using AgendaFilter's prohibit a
ruleflow-group with no activations being detected.  Conversely, the API for
(de)activating a ruleflow-group seems gone; what is the best way of changing
the ruleflow-group from the current group to the one that should execute
next (i.e., the next one in the ruleflow)?
